What are the responsibilities and job description for the Plant Engineer (Power Plant) position at International Staffing Consultants, Inc.?
Company is seeking to hire a Plant Engineer to support the station with planned maintenance activities, troubleshooting of technical issues, overseeing / assisting with Capital and O&M projects and outages, while ensuring safety and environmental compliance in order to optimize station processes and reliability. The Plant Engineer will report directly to the Plant Manager.
Detailed Job Description
- Provide technical assistance to operations and maintenance departments in support of repairs and / or maintenance of station equipment consistent with the relative and applicable codes and standards.
- Assist in the planning and execution of scheduled outages, including development and maintaining outage schedules.
- Serve as Outage Coordinator for all scheduled outages by interacting with the station's Management, Engineering, Operations and Maintenance teams during these outages.
- Work with the station managers to evaluate and establish goals and objectives focused on process improvement, and responsible equipment operations.
- Assist in the development and optimization of an effective PM program to ensure plant equipment is operated and maintained consistent with manufacturer's specifications.
- Project management for O&M and capital projects that includes development RFP Packages with design drawings and specification(s) as required, review of bid evaluations for constructability, and provide technical recommendations for award, manage contracts and contractors to facilitate the completion of the projects.
- Assist in updating and optimizing the station's design basis documents and database such as drawings, system descriptions, and control narratives, etc.
- Perform incident investigations and failure root cause analysis as necessary.
- Perform condition assessment of all plant equipment to support continued viability and maintenance schedule.
- Assist in performing testing, repairing and preventative maintenance on hydraulic, electrical, and electronic control systems and instrumentation.
- Establish preliminary project work scope, budget, and schedule with guidance from Managers and Labor Group Supervisors.
